 roup at the Department of Materials Science in Cambridge! \n \n"Modern met
 hods for computing the properties of realistic materials from first princi
 ples (starting from quantum mechanics) have led to a creation of robust\, 
 efficient\, and widely used computer codes. Coupled with the explosion of 
 available computational resources\, it has become possible to search throu
 gh the vast space of compositions and arrangements of atoms to discover ne
 w materials with extreme properties. A recent highlight is the realisation
  of record breaking superconductivity in the dense super-hydrides - hydrog
 en sulphide (Tc=204K) and lanthanum hydride (Tc=260K)."\n \nThe talk is fr
